Comprehending LLCs and Corporations
LLCs, or LLCs, are a widespread business structure that combines the agility of a joint venture with the security of a corporate structure. An Limited Liability Company provides its owners, known as members, limited personal liability for the debts and actions of the business. This means that personal assets like houses or financial reserves are usually protected from business liabilities. Because of their flexible management structure and pass-through taxation, limited liability companies are often preferred by entrepreneurs and business founders.
Corporations, on the other hand, constitute more complex entities that provide the highest degree of personal liability safeguards. This arrangement allows for the raising of capital through the sale of shares and has a more structured structure with shareholders, directors, and officers. Corporate entities are subject to additional regulations and reporting requirements, which can render them more cumbersome to manage compared to LLCs. However, the capability to go public and access larger capital markets can be significant advantages.
When evaluating business formation, both LLCs and corporations have their advantages. The best option often depends on the particular requirements of the enterprise, such as the level of acceptable individual risk, tax implications, and projections for growth. The Way to Conduct an LLC Regional Inquiry
Performing an LLC state search is a crucial phase for individuals looking to obtain information about a restricted liability company. Begin by identifying the specific state you want to look into because each state holds its own business registration database. For example, if you are interested in businesses incorporated in Florida, you should conduct an LLC state of Florida query, while a Wyoming would need to conduct a state of Wyoming corp inquiry database search. Entry to these databases is usually provided through government websites, making it simple to locate the necessary resources.
Once you have accessed to the correct state database, you will commonly be greeted with a search interface where you can type the name of the LLC or the business number, if known to you. It is important to input the name correctly to yield the most accurate results. Numerous states also provide the option to search by business owner or registered agent, which can also be beneficial if you are having trouble pinpointing the specific LLC.
In conclusion, after conducting the search, check the findings for useful information. This may include the company's status, formation date, designated agent, and sometimes even documents submitted with the state.
